Дипломный проект на тему: Программа-эмулятор для реализации алгоритма Маркова
Сфера использования
Нормальные алгоритмы маркова
Структурная схема программы
Главное окно программы
Окна открытия и сохранения файла
Окно добавления команды
Программная реализация подстановок
Справка пользователя
О программе
Доклад окончен. Спасибо за внимание!
436.46K
Category: programmingprogramming

Программа-эмулятор для реализации алгоритма Маркова

1. Дипломный проект на тему: Программа-эмулятор для реализации алгоритма Маркова

Дипломный проект на
тему: Программаэмулятор для реализации
алгоритма Маркова
Выполнил Корогодов В. А.

2. Сфера использования

Выполнение
составлению
и
практических
реализации
работ
по
нормальных
алгоритмов Маркова студентами техникума
Проверка
работоспособности
и
правильности написанного алгоритма НАМ

3. Нормальные алгоритмы маркова

Нормальный алгоритм Маркова –непустой
конечный упорядоченный набор формул
подстановки.
Формула подстановки – запись вида α→β,
где α и β – любые слова.
Формула применяется к некоторому слову
Р.
В
слове
Р
отыскивается
часть,
совпадающая с левой частью этой
формулы, и она заменяется на правую
часть формулы.
Результат подстановки – получившееся

4. Структурная схема программы

5. Главное окно программы

6. Окна открытия и сохранения файла

7. Окно добавления команды

8. Программная реализация подстановок

a:=pos(f,d); - определение позиции
вхождения строки f в строку d
b:=length(f); - определение длины строки
f
delete(d,a,b); - удаление из строки d b
символов, начиная с позиции а
insert(c,d,a); - добавление строки с в
строку d, начиная с позиции а

9. Справка пользователя

10. О программе

11. Доклад окончен. Спасибо за внимание!

English     Русский Rules